Group Leader - Weekend Evening Shift (Fri-Sun 4:45pm-5am)(Saturdays 4:45pm-3am)
AEO · Ottawa, KS, Canada
About The Role
YOUR ROLE
As a Group Leader, you are the DC Operations Supervisors right hand. You will lead other team members and coordinate workflow within the department to ensure merchandise is processed and shipped in a safe, timely, accurate manner. You are the primary trainer for new hires, teaching others best practices while maintaining a culture of safety. When not training or leading, the Group Leader will physically assist the team in material handling and merchandise processing.
